On 12/18/21 07:38, Patrice Dumas wrote:
The idea is that it would be set if doing XHTML 1.1, be it for epub or
as an output, as it is a prerequisite for epub if I understood right.

For now, my plan is to do XHTML1.1 as a separate init file.

Why? XHTML 1.1 is an obsolete format.  It is not required for EPUB 3.x,
which is a 10-year old specification.

EPUB does requires content document to be XML:
http://idpf.org/epub/30/spec/epub30-contentdocs.html#sec-xhtml

However, my reading of the spec finds no indications that custom data 
attributes are
disallowed.  It notes that data attributes must be stripped before being fed
to a validator - which implies that they are allowed, but the validator does 
not handle them:
http://idpf.org/epub/30/spec/epub30-contentdocs.html#app-xhtml-schema

So my recommendation is: Just leave the data attributes in, even for XHTML/EPUB.
